One Health is the globally understood umbrella term for the interconnectedness of human, animal and environmental health. The One Health 2019 national conference, held in Dorset on 6th September, has been deemed a great success and was supported by government, national businesses and over 20 support organisations and agencies, including the SETsquared Partnership, all four national Agri-Centres and Innovate UK. At the conference, a programme of One Health support activities was launched, including a national Aquaculture Expo in the spring 2020. The Expo event will bring together Aquaculture companies with buyers, investors, government, universities and others with early bird booking for exhibitors and delegates will go live in November 2019 – more on this next month.

The SETsquared Partnership

One Health Campaign

SETsquared will be investing up to £100k from its Stimulus Fund into R&D project proposal development for major, upcoming One Health funding calls.

Applications of up to £35k per project will be welcomed from companies (including UK Scale-Ups, Primes/OEMs and their supply chains), researchers from the universities of Bath, Bristol, Cardiff, Exeter, Southampton and Surrey and consortia (comprised of companies & researchers). The funds can be used for:

  • consortia building
  • securing grant funding & private investment
  • proposal development for business-led collaborative R&D.

Heard of the British Business Bank?

The British Business Bank (BBB) is a government-owned business development bank dedicated to making finance markets work better for smaller businesses. Whether you’re looking for finance to start a business, grow to the next level, or stay ahead of the competition, they say that they can deliver greater volume and choice of finance.
